| Santa Cruz Biotechnology search Santa Cruz Biotechnology NTRK2 products | | ih | Santa Cruz rabbit polyclonal anti-TrkB antibody(sc-12) was used in immunohistochemistry to study the role of BDNF-TrkB signaling in regulation of adult hippocampal neurogenesis in sections from mices. to the paper | | ih | Santa Cruz rabbit and goat anti-TrkB antibodies were used in rat neurons and in immunohistochemistry to study the role for up-regulation of calcitonin gene-related peptide and receptor tyrosine kinase TrkB in rat bladder afferent neurons following TNBS colitis. to the paper | | wb | Santa Cruz Biotechnology trkB antiserum (sc-12) map to C-terminal region was used in western blot to study the development of brain-derived neurotrophic factor mRNA and protein in the rat hippocampus regulated by estrogen. to the paper | | ih | Santa Cruz Biotechnology rabbit polyclonal anti-TrkB antibody was used in immunohistochemistry to study the role for NGF signaling in human limbal epithelium expanded by amniotic membrane culture. to the paper |
| Millipore search Millipore NTRK2 products | | wb | Upstate Biotechnology TrkB antibody was used in western blot to study cell-autonomous role of TrkB in the establishment of hippocampal Schaffer collateral synapses. to the paper |
